Fabric Qualities

At House of Vinterberg, every suit begins with a principle: nature knows best.
We work exclusively with Natural fibers – Wool, Virgin Wool, Merino Wool, and Cashmere. Because we believe true luxury is not just seen, but felt.
These materials breathe with you, move with you, and age with grace. They regulate temperature naturally, resist odors, and drape with an elegance that synthetic fabrics simply can’t replicate.
These are not just fabrics; they are living materials that respond to your body and environment, offering comfort and sophistication in equal measure.



Polyester's Hidden Costs

In contrast, polyester suits – often marketed as “easy-care” or “budget-friendly” – come at a hidden cost.
They trap heat, resist breathability, and lack the graceful aging of natural fibers.
Over time, they lose their shape, sheen, and soul. For us, that’s not a compromise worth making.

Full Canvas - Handmade

Our full canvas handmade make is the choice of traditionalists, those who appreciate craftsmanship through delivering the best quality product.

Notable handwork details include multiple canvas layers from shoulder to hem, pick stitching, buttonholes, collar attachment, lining armhole, lining shoulder seam, chest pocket, and your brand label attachment.

Full Canvas

This construction incorporates multiple layers of canvas from shoulder to jacket hem, and requires little interlining.

Made using varying compositions of natural fibres, the canvas gradually moulds to the wearer over time, resulting in the jacket feeling natural to the wearer. The drape and longevity is unrivalled, and certainly something worth experiencing.

Half Canvas

The traditional half canvas construction incorporates multiple layers of canvas from the shoulder down through the chest, lapels, and finishes at the top button point.

Half canvas jackets strike a desirable balance when compared to other makes – Better structure and shape than fused, whilst remaining lighter and less structured than full canvas.

Unconstructed

The unconstructed make is an excellent option for customers seeking something much less structured and relaxed to wear.

In this make, the main chest canvas is removed, leaving only a small canvas piece in the shoulder area to ensure a clean appearance through the shoulder line and upper area of the jacket. This make is always constructed in combination with no shoulder padding.
